Windows 11 Access Denied Issue on Samsung Laptops

Microsoft is investigating an issue affecting Samsung laptops running Windows 11 after the February 2026 security updates. Users lose access to the C:\ drive and cannot launch applications, encountering 'C:\ is not accessible – Access denied' errors. The problem impacts Windows 11 versions 25H2 and 24H2, primarily affecting Samsung Galaxy Book 4 devices in Brazil, Portugal, South Korea, and India. The issue may be related to the Samsung Share application, though the exact cause is unconfirmed. A workaround exists but weakens security by changing ownership of system files.
